The narrative follows Amy Loughren (Jessica Chastain), a struggling ICU nurse and single mother suffering from a life-threatening heart condition. When the hospital hires Charles Cullen (Eddie Redmayne), he quickly becomes a close friend and a vital support system for Amy. However, after a series of mysterious patient deaths, Amy is approached by detectives and forced to confront the horrifying reality that her confidant is systematically murdering patients by contaminating IV bags with lethal doses of insulin and digoxin. The title serves a dual purpose. While Cullen is the nominal "nurse," the film argues that Amy is the "good nurse" not just through her clinical skill, but through her ultimate act of bravery in assisting the police at great personal and professional risk.
